Identification of a particular cheese production by trace analysis with nuclear techniques

CAGNAZZO, MARCELLA;BORIO DI TIGLIOLE, ANDREA;
2006-01-01

Abstract

The counterfeit of a product, in this case a type of cheese, is an economic damage for the trade-mark product. An identification of the product itself by quantification of trace elements could be done. Nuclear techniques are useful and give good results. Some elements are connected to the process so different productions could be identified. Thirty elements and 160 spectrums are analysed. The samples of the same kind of cheese come from different countries and different Italian producers (15 different productions).
